01 · The Link

5G / 4G WAN.
Connectivity Anywhere.

The TGW3120 delivers enterprise-grade network connectivity to any site that lacks fixed fibre infrastructure — outdoor venues, temporary event spaces, construction sites, remote facilities, retail pop-ups, and locations where waiting for a fibre circuit is not an option. The integrated 5G modem connects to available cellular networks and presents a fully managed WAN connection to the rest of your network stack, with automatic fallback from 5G to 4G/LTE ensuring uptime across varying signal conditions.

02 · The Redundancy

Dual SIM.
Carrier Failover.

Two independent SIM slots allow the TGW3120 to connect to two different cellular carriers simultaneously. When the primary carrier's signal degrades or the network is unavailable, the gateway automatically switches to the secondary SIM — maintaining connectivity without any manual intervention. For deployments in areas where a single carrier has patchy coverage, or for organisations that require contractual uptime guarantees across multiple ISPs, dual SIM is the cellular equivalent of dual WAN.

03 · The Interfaces

PoE Out.
Fiber. GPIO.

The TGW3120 is not just a cellular modem — it is a full multi-interface gateway. Four RJ45 PoE-out ports power and connect access points, cameras, and other devices directly. Fiber LC ports extend the network over single-mode or multi-mode fiber to distant equipment without signal loss. A GPIO terminal block enables direct integration with industrial sensors, alarms, access control systems, and automation equipment — making the TGW3120 equally at home in an IT cabinet or an industrial control panel.

04 · In Control

Remote Deploy.
EZELINK Managed.

Zero Touch Provisioning means the TGW3120 configures itself on first power-up — insert the SIM cards, connect antennas, apply power, and the device registers with the EZELINK cloud and downloads its full configuration automatically. No on-site engineer, no console session, no manual setup. Remote monitoring, firmware updates, VPN tunnels, and security policies are all managed from EZELINK's GCC NOC.
